Mtlh2010 Posted January 8, 2017 Author Share #10 Posted January 8, 2017 And another example of a fully embroidered 3rd Marine Division (3MARDIV) shoulder patch with the yellow & black reversed. This one was still sewn to the sleeve fabric of a badly damaged tunic. Reverse side shows classic WW2-era white bobbin threads.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
